The BOM is not 65257 (bytes xFE xFF) in a SPARQL Update request, it's bytes xEF xBB xBF.

We are talking about what is on-the-wire which means UTF-8 encoded unicode and codepoint 65257, U+FEFF is 3 bytes in UTF-8 xEF xBB xBF

http://unicode.org/faq/utf_bom.html#bom4

The bytes xFE xFF are illegal as UTF-8 hence the message you see.

$ echo -n $'\uFEFF' | od -t x1
==>
0000000 ef bb bf
0000003

$ echo -n $'\xFE\xFF' | od -t x1
==>
0000000 fe ff
0000002

The fact that the 500 does not say where the error in the input stream occurs is an unfortunate effect of efficient decoding by java and by javacc. It processes large blocks of bytes and does not say where in the block the error occurred. This is a nuisance.

What is legal is to put the unicode encoding "\uFEFF" into the SPARQL Update.
